Re: Need help in JAVA

import java.awt.Button;
import java.awt.Component;
import java.awt.Container;
import java.awt.Dimension;
import java.awt.Font;
import java.awt.Graphics;
import java.awt.GridBagConstraints;
import java.awt.GridBagLayout;
import java.awt.Insets;
import java.awt.Label;
import java.awt.Rectangle;
import java.awt.event.ActionEvent;
import java.awt.event.ActionListener;
import java.awt.event.KeyAdapter;
import java.awt.event.KeyEvent;


public class Game extends Object {
	protected javax.swing.Timer timer;
        protected long startTime;

    private SquareBoard board = null;

    private SquareBoard previewBoard = new SquareBoard(5, 5);


    private Figure[] figures = {
        new Figure(Figure.SQUARE_FIGURE),
        new Figure(Figure.LINE_FIGURE),
        new Figure(Figure.S_FIGURE),
        new Figure(Figure.Z_FIGURE),
        new Figure(Figure.RIGHT_ANGLE_FIGURE),
        new Figure(Figure.LEFT_ANGLE_FIGURE),
        new Figure(Figure.TRIANGLE_FIGURE)
    };


    private GamePanel component = null;

    private GameThread thread = null;


    private int level = 1;

    private int score = 0;


    private Figure figure = null;

    private Figure nextFigure = null;

    private int nextRotation = 0;


    private boolean preview = true;


    private boolean moveLock = false;

    public Game() {
        this(10, 20);
    }


    public Game(int width, int height) {
        board = new SquareBoard(width, height);
        board.setMessage("Press start");
        thread = new GameThread();
    }


    public void quit() {
        thread = null;
    }


    public Component getComponent() {
        if (component == null) {
            component = new GamePanel();
        }
        return component;
    }

    
    private void handleStart() {

        // Reset score and figures
        level = 1;
        score = 0;
        figure = null;
        nextFigure = randomFigure();
        nextFigure.rotateRandom();
        nextRotation = nextFigure.getRotation();  

        // Reset components
        board.setMessage(null);
        board.clear();
        previewBoard.clear();
        handleLevelModification();
        handleScoreModification();
        component.button.setLabel("Pause");

        // Start game thread
        thread.reset();
    }


    private void handleGameOver() {
        handleTimeModification();
        // Stop game thred
        thread.setPaused(true);

        // Reset figures
        if (figure != null) {
            figure.detach();
        }
        figure = null;
        if (nextFigure != null) {
            nextFigure.detach();
        }
        nextFigure = null;

        // Handle components
        board.setMessage("Game Over");
        component.button.setLabel("Start");
    }

    private void handlePause() {
        thread.setPaused(true);
        board.setMessage("Paused");
        component.button.setLabel("Resume");
    }

    private void handleResume() {
        board.setMessage(null);
        component.button.setLabel("Pause");
        thread.setPaused(false);
    }

    private void handleLevelModification() {
        component.levelLabel.setText("Level: " + level);
        thread.adjustSpeed();
  

    }
    
 
    private void handleScoreModification() {
        component.scoreLabel.setText("Score: " + score);
    }
    
    private void handleTimeModification () {
        long delta = (System.currentTimeMillis() - startTime)/10;
        component.timeLabel.setText("Time: " + Double.toString(delta/100.0) + " seconds");
    }

    private void handleFigureStart() {
        int  rotation;


        // Move next figure to current
        figure = nextFigure;
        moveLock = false;
        rotation = nextRotation;
        nextFigure = randomFigure();
        nextFigure.rotateRandom(); 
        nextRotation = nextFigure.getRotation(); 

        // Handle figure preview
        if (preview) {
            previewBoard.clear(); 
            nextFigure.attach(previewBoard, true);
            nextFigure.detach();
        }

        // Attach figure to game board
        figure.setRotation(rotation);
        if (!figure.attach(board, false)) {
            previewBoard.clear();
            figure.attach(previewBoard, true);
            figure.detach();
            handleGameOver();
        }
    }


    private void handleFigureLanded() {

        // Check and detach figure
        if (figure.isAllVisible()) {
            score += 10;
            handleScoreModification();
        } else {
            handleGameOver();
            return;
        }
        figure.detach();
        figure = null;

        // Check for full lines or create new figure
        if (board.hasFullLines()) {
            board.removeFullLines();
            if (level < 9 && board.getRemovedLines() / 20 > level) {
                level = board.getRemovedLines() / 20;
                handleLevelModification();
            }
        } else {
            handleFigureStart();
        }
    }


    private synchronized void handleTimer() {
        if (figure == null) {
            handleFigureStart();

        } else if (figure.hasLanded()) {
            handleFigureLanded();
        } else {
            figure.moveDown();
        }
    }


    private synchronized void handleButtonPressed() {
        if (nextFigure == null) {
            handleStart();
        } else if (thread.isPaused()) {
            handleResume();
        } else {
            handlePause();
        }
    }


    private synchronized void handleKeyEvent(KeyEvent e) {

        // Handle start, pause and resume
        if (e.getKeyCode() == KeyEvent.VK_P) {
            handleButtonPressed();
                                timer.start();
                    startTime = System.currentTimeMillis();
            return;
        }

        // Don't proceed if stopped or paused
        if (figure == null || moveLock || thread.isPaused()) {
            return;
        }

        // Handle remaining key events
        switch (e.getKeyCode()) {

        case KeyEvent.VK_LEFT:
            figure.moveLeft();
            break;

        case KeyEvent.VK_RIGHT:
            figure.moveRight();
            break;

        case KeyEvent.VK_DOWN:
            figure.moveAllWayDown();
            moveLock = true;
            break;

        case KeyEvent.VK_UP:
        case KeyEvent.VK_SPACE:
            if (e.isControlDown()) {
                figure.rotateRandom();  
            } else if (e.isShiftDown()) { 
                figure.rotateClockwise();
            } else {
                figure.rotateCounterClockwise();
            }
            break;

        case KeyEvent.VK_S:
            if (level < 9) {
                level++;
                handleLevelModification();
            }
            break;

        case KeyEvent.VK_N:
            preview = !preview;
            if (preview && figure != nextFigure) {
                nextFigure.attach(previewBoard, true);
                nextFigure.detach(); 
            } else {
                previewBoard.clear();
            }
            break;
        }
    }


    private Figure randomFigure() {
        return figures[(int) (Math.random() * figures.length)];
    }



    private class GameThread extends Thread {

        private boolean paused = true;


        private int sleepTime = 500;

   
        public GameThread() {
        }


        public void reset() {
            adjustSpeed();
            setPaused(false);
            if (!isAlive()) {
                this.start();
            }
        }


        public boolean isPaused() {
            return paused;
        }


        public void setPaused(boolean paused) {
            this.paused = paused;
        }


        public void adjustSpeed() {
            sleepTime = 4500 / (level + 5) - 250;
            if (sleepTime < 50) {
                sleepTime = 50;
            }
        }

        public void run() {
            while (thread == this) {
                // Make the time step
                handleTimer();

                // Sleep for some time
                try {
                    Thread.sleep(sleepTime);
                } catch (InterruptedException ignore) {
                    // Do nothing
                }

                // Sleep if paused
                while (paused && thread == this) {
                    try {
                        Thread.sleep(1000);
                    } catch (InterruptedException ignore) {
                        // Do nothing
                    }
                }
            }
        }
    }



    private class GamePanel extends Container {
        

        private Dimension  size = null;

 
        private Label scoreLabel = new Label("Score: 0");

    
        private Label levelLabel = new Label("Level: 1");
        
        private Label timeLabel = new Label("Time: ");

   
        private Button button = new Button("Start");


        public GamePanel() {
            super();
            initComponents();
        }


        public void paint(Graphics g) {
            Rectangle  rect = g.getClipBounds();

            if (size == null || !size.equals(getSize())) {
                size = getSize();
                resizeComponents();
            }
            g.setColor(getBackground());
            g.fillRect(rect.x, rect.y, rect.width, rect.height);
            super.paint(g);
        }
        

        private void initComponents() {
            GridBagConstraints  c;

            // Set layout manager and background
            setLayout(new GridBagLayout());
            setBackground(Configuration.getColor("background", "#d4d0c8"));

            // Add game board
            c = new GridBagConstraints();
            c.gridx = 0;
            c.gridy = 0;
            c.gridheight = 4;
            c.weightx = 1.0;
            c.weighty = 1.0;
            c.fill = GridBagConstraints.BOTH;
            this.add(board.getComponent(), c);

            // Add next figure board
            c = new GridBagConstraints();
            c.gridx = 1;
            c.gridy = 0;
            c.weightx = 0.2;
            c.weighty = 0.18;
            c.fill = GridBagConstraints.BOTH;
            c.insets = new Insets(15, 15, 0, 15);
            this.add(previewBoard.getComponent(), c);

            // Add score label
            scoreLabel.setForeground(Configuration.getColor("label", 
                                                            "#000000"));
            scoreLabel.setAlignment(Label.CENTER);
            c = new GridBagConstraints();
            c.gridx = 1;
            c.gridy = 1;
            c.weightx = 0.3;
            c.weighty = 0.05;
            c.anchor = GridBagConstraints.CENTER;
            c.fill = GridBagConstraints.BOTH;
            c.insets = new Insets(0, 15, 0, 15);
            this.add(scoreLabel, c);

            // Add level label
            levelLabel.setForeground(Configuration.getColor("label", 
                                                            "#000000"));
            levelLabel.setAlignment(Label.CENTER);
            c = new GridBagConstraints();
            c.gridx = 1;
            c.gridy = 2;
            c.weightx = 0.3;
            c.weighty = 0.05;
            c.anchor = GridBagConstraints.CENTER;
            c.fill = GridBagConstraints.BOTH;
            c.insets = new Insets(0, 15, 0, 15);
            this.add(levelLabel, c);
            
            // Add time label
            timeLabel.setForeground(Configuration.getColor("label", 
                                                            "#000000"));
            timeLabel.setAlignment(Label.CENTER);
            c = new GridBagConstraints();
            c.gridx = 1;
            c.gridy = 5;
            c.weightx = 0.3;
            c.weighty = 0.05;
            c.anchor = GridBagConstraints.CENTER;
            c.fill = GridBagConstraints.BOTH;
            c.insets = new Insets(0, 15, 0, 15);
            this.add(timeLabel, c);

            // Add generic button
            button.setBackground(Configuration.getColor("button", "#d4d0c8"));
            c = new GridBagConstraints();
            c.gridx = 1;
            c.gridy = 3;
            c.weightx = 0.3;
            c.weighty = 1.0;
            c.anchor = GridBagConstraints.NORTH;
            c.fill = GridBagConstraints.HORIZONTAL;
            c.insets = new Insets(15, 15, 15, 15);
            this.add(button, c);

            // Add event handling            
            enableEvents(KeyEvent.KEY_EVENT_MASK);
            this.addKeyListener(new KeyAdapter() {
                public void keyPressed(KeyEvent e) {
                    handleKeyEvent(e);
                }
            });
            button.addActionListener(new ActionListener() {
                public void actionPerformed(ActionEvent e) {
                    handleButtonPressed();
                    component.requestFocus();
                }
            });
        }
        

        private void resizeComponents() {
            Dimension  size = scoreLabel.getSize();
            Font       font;
            int        unitSize;
            
            // Calculate the unit size
            size = board.getComponent().getSize();
            size.width /= board.getBoardWidth();
            size.height /= board.getBoardHeight();
            if (size.width > size.height) {
                unitSize = size.height;
            } else {
                unitSize = size.width;
            }

            // Adjust font sizes
            font = new Font("SansSerif", 
                            Font.BOLD, 
                            3 + (int) (unitSize / 1.8));
            scoreLabel.setFont(font);
            levelLabel.setFont(font);
            timeLabel.setFont(font);
            font = new Font("SansSerif", 
                            Font.PLAIN, 
                            2 + unitSize / 2);
            button.setFont(font);
            
            // Invalidate layout
            scoreLabel.invalidate();
            levelLabel.invalidate();
            timeLabel.invalidate();
            button.invalidate();
        }
    }
}

After I added the timer into this game, the total time that player played before the game over is 1.20525530456E9 seconds. It's so weird... And also after I enlarged the application and resize, there are some problems with the interface. Hope to get some help with these... Thanks
